Hey all..Here is that image of M101 I took the other night. Was a little hesitant to post because of the F3.3 vignetting issue. But what the heck. Need to learn flats. I know alot of data is being clipped as I try to even out the gradient. I am pleased with the tracking though. Stars are more round. 20x600secs.Star2k. Used Chris Icoughs starbloat and tweaked in PS. As always comments and tweaking welcome. Thanks for looking. Ken Tydeck
